Bertram Keightley's Lectures In America is a book published by Theosophical Publishing Society that features a collection of lectures given by Bertram Keightley during his tour in America. Keightley was a prominent member of the Theosophical Society and a close associate of its founders, Helena Blavatsky and Henry Olcott. The lectures cover a wide range of topics related to Theosophy, including the nature of reality, the spiritual evolution of humanity, and the role of Theosophy in modern society. Keightley's lectures are known for their clarity and accessibility, making them an excellent introduction to the principles of Theosophy for both new and experienced readers. The book also includes an introduction by the editor and a brief biography of Bertram Keightley.
